Atualização do Ubuntu 16.04 para desktop, agora quebrada - não pode descriptografar o disco

1

Eu estava atualizando o Ubuntu 16.04 e ele ficou pendurado em:

Setting up grub2-common (2.02~beta2-36ubuntu3.17) ...
Setting up grub-efi-amd64-bin (2.02~beta2-36ubuntu3.17) ...
Setting up grub-efi-amd64 (2.02~beta2-36ubuntu3.17) ...
Installing for x86_64-efi platform.

Agora sei que isso provavelmente foi uma estupidez, mas eu desliguei a máquina depois de um tempo, e o Ubuntu não inicializa mais corretamente. No prompt do grub, localizei os arquivos relevantes e executei:

root=(hd0,gpt2)
linux /vmlinuz-4.10.0-33-generic
initrd /initrd.img-4.10.0-33-generic
boot

e depois inicializa no grub, até "Por favor desbloqueie o disco sda3_crypt:"

Eu tentei a senha usual, e todas as combinações que consigo pensar, mas não são desbloqueadas - "cryptosetup falhou".

Eu me lembro de um problema com o layout do teclado trocando dois dos personagens quando eu fiz a frase secreta pela primeira vez, então eu me pergunto se isso tem algo a ver com isso? Parece que a inicialização está funcionando, mas é possível restaurar a versão GUI desse aviso de desbloqueio? Pensei que isso poderia ajudar a inserir a frase-senha correta se for algo relacionado ao layout do teclado.

Desde então, eu também iniciei um live CD e usei o boot-repair, mas isso não restaurou a GUI.

OK, update: eu usei crytosetup -v luksOpen / dev / sda3 sda3_crypt, a partir do prompt > initramfs que foi deixado depois que ele falhou ao decifrar / boot - parece que está no layout do teclado dos EUA como suspeito, eu entrei no Passphrase pressionando as teclas que seria a senha correta no layout dos EUA (em vez do teclado do Reino Unido), e ele diz Key slot 0 desbloqueado, o que eu acho que é o progresso? Apenas fica aqui no entanto.

Sucesso! Eu acho que ... Reiniciei, e entrei usando a combinação de teclas alterada, e agora descriptografa - eu acho que o acima apenas me deu mais chances de experimentar senhas, que era o objetivo enquanto eu estava farto de reiniciar - então disse: Bem-vindo ao modo de emergência .. Eu não tinha certeza do que era e depois de um pouco de faffing ao redor (update-grub, grub-install etc não funcionou), eu reiniciei e entrada "normal" em vez de "boot" no grub e agora estou no ubuntu full GUI. No entanto boot ainda está quebrado, então como consertar - talvez possa ter que deixar este até amanhã, mas parece um pouco de sucesso, qualquer entrada em para onde ir a partir daqui seria muito apreciada como só posso inicializar através grub no momento ( tentei atualizar-grub através do GUI do Ubuntu, sem erros, mas não corrigi-lo).

    
por sumade 01.03.2018 / 00:31

2 respostas

1

Como você ainda tem acesso ao seu sistema (se não, faça isso após montar seu FS via liveUSB / CD), tente executar:

sudo grub-install /dev/sda3
sudo grub-install --recheck /dev/sda3
sudo update-grub

Veja Como fazer o Ubuntu: como reparar / reinstale o Grub2 para ler mais.

    
por Simon Van Machin 01.03.2018 / 21:30
0

Eu tive exatamente o mesmo problema quando atualizado 16.04 semanas atrás. Também meu sistema foi criptografado.

Eu não consegui resolver com essas diferentes atualizações manuais do grub.

Crie persistente ubuntulive usb que mantém suas configurações e outras mudanças, ajuda muito quando reinicia o sistema muitas vezes.

Então, via ubuntulive:

cryptsetup open --type luks /dev/sda3 lvm
mkdir /mnt/a3
mount /dev/ubuntu-vg/root /mnt/a3
cd /mnt/a3

abriu todo o resto do meu diretório pessoal onde eu tinha a maior parte do conteúdo. (Quando você instala o Ubuntu, em seguida, na adição de todo o disco LUKS, há essa opção para ter criptografia extra para o diretório inicial, descobriu que sua criptografia é aberta apenas quando você dá sua senha do Ubuntu).

Para o meu caso

sudo ecryptfs-recover-private

com esta desmontagem sugerida de gvfs resolvida: "sudo ecryptfs-recover- private "dá" find: '/ run / user / 1000 / gvfs': Permissão negada "- Arquivos perdidos?

dessa forma eu peguei uma cópia dos meus arquivos. Depois de todos eles eu ainda tentei atualizar o grub, mas não consegui e finalmente re-instalei o Ubuntu, desta vez sem a criptografia do diretório home (porque eu tenho LUKS mesmo assim).

    
por user728938 06.03.2018 / 08:13